Replacing a PCIe Riser Card Assembly
The qualified and supported part numbers for this component are subject to change over time. For the most
up-to-date list of replaceable components, see the following URL and then scroll to
Technical Specifications
:
http://www.cisco.com/en/US/products/ps10493/products_data_sheets_list.html
To replace a PCIe riser card assembly, follow these steps:
Step 1
Remove a PCIe riser card assembly:
a.
Power off the server as described in the
“Shutting Down and Powering Off the Server” section on
page 3-9
.
b.
Disconnect all power cords from the power supplies.
c.
Slide the server out the front of the rack far enough so that you can remove the top cover. You might
have to detach cables from the rear panel to provide clearance.
Caution
If you cannot safely view and access the component, remove the server from the rack.
d.
Remove the top cover as described in the
“Removing and Replacing the Server Top Cover” section
on page 3-10
.
